How much do activation analyst j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 12, 2026, the average yearly pay for activation analyst in the United States is $71,511.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$54,500.00 and $79,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an activation analyst?

To thrive as an Activation Analyst, you generally need str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and a bachelor's degree in business, marketing, or a related field. Familiarity with data analysis tools such as Excel, SQL, CRM systems, and sometimes marketing automation platforms is typically required. Excellent communication, problem-solving abilities, and project management skills help you collaborate effectively with cross-functional teams and manage multiple campaigns. These competencies are vital for ensuring accurate campaign execution, optimizing performance, and delivering measurable business results.

What are some common challenges activation analysts face when coordinating cross-functional teams during campaign launches?

Activation Analysts often work closely with marketing, sales, and technical teams to ensure successful campaign launches. One common challenge is balancing differing priorities across departments while ensuring that deliverables are met on tight deadlines. Effective communication and strong project management skills are essential to align stakeholders and resolve any data discrepancies. Additionally, Activation Analysts must quickly adapt to shifting campaign requirements and troubleshoot issues as they arise to maintain a smooth activation process.

What is the difference between Activation Analyst vs Campaign Analyst?

AspectActivation AnalystCampaign Analyst
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in marketing, business, or related field; certifications like Google Analytics or CRM toolsBachelor's degree in marketing, data analysis, or related; similar certifications often required
Work EnvironmentMarketing teams, digital platforms, client-facing rolesMarketing departments, data-driven environments, client or internal campaigns
Employer & Industry UsageRetail, e-commerce, digital marketing agenciesAdvertising agencies, retail, e-commerce, digital marketing

Both Activation Analysts and Campaign Analysts work within marketing and digital environments, often sharing similar educational backgrounds and certifications. Activation Analysts focus on executing and optimizing activation strategies, while Campaign Analysts analyze campaign performance data to inform future strategies. Their roles are complementary, with overlapping skills in data analysis and digital tools, but they differ in their primary focus areas.

Brand Activation Manager, Hybrid, Easton PA

GENERAL SUMMARY:

Creative, strategic, and highly collaborative to bring our brand to life in meaningful, engaging ways. This role will be instrumental in planning and executing annual marketing activation strategies that drive awareness, engagement, consideration, and conversion across key product, platform, seasonal, and brand priorities.

An experienced marketer who thrives at the intersection of strategy and execution, brings a global mindset, and excels in cross‑functional collaboration. You are energized by turning insights into action and passionate about delivering best‑in‑class consumer and shopper experiences.

PRINCIPAL D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ES:

Marketing Activation Planning & Execution:

  • Support the planning and development of annual marketing activation strategies that drive awareness, engagement, consideration, and conversion for priority products, platforms, seasons, and brand initiatives.
  • Lead the execution and implementation of activation plans, partnering closely with activation, platform, shopper, digital, partnerships, and sales teams to achieve annual commercial objectives.
  • Serve as a key liaison between platform, activation, sales, and global marketing teams to ensure connectivity, collaboration, efficiency, and alignment with marketing priorities and goals.
  • Translate product, audience, and marketplace insights into actionable, relevant, and demand‑driving campaigns and activations.
  • Create and manage activation toolkits that align marketing with sales, global teams, and agency partners.
  • Craft and share clear, compelling activation briefs with platform, agency, global, and activation partners.
  • Execute activation plans within approved budgets and timelines, ensuring strong alignment with overall business priorities.
  • Partner with global marketing leads to share activation plans, assets, results, and best practices, driving consistency and scale where appropriate.
  • Own post‑activation analysis, highlighting successes, marketplace impact, best practices, and opportunities for improvement.
  • Maintain and update the global marketing scorecard on a quarterly basis to track performance and inform future planning.

Shopper Marketing Support:

In partnership with the Manager, Shopper Marketing

  • Plan and activate retail marketing programs across Grocery, Craft, Education, Office, and Value channels to drive demand for priority products.
  • Provide activation strategy, assets, and support to retail partners, ensuring alignment with national and enterprise‑wide programs.
  • Serve as a liaison between sales teams and activation partners to enable fast, collaborative execution and marketplace synergy.
  • Deliver post‑program analysis to assess effectiveness, efficiency, and ROI, and inform continuous improvement.

JOB SPECIFICATIONS:

  • 5+ years of experience in integrated marketing, brand activation, or related roles.
  • Bachelor’s degree in Marketing or a related discipline; advanced coursework or certifications a plus.
  • Shopper marketing and global brand experience strongly preferred.
  • Proficient Microsoft Office skills

Capabilities & Mindset

  • Strategic Mindset: Ability to translate brand vision and commercial goals into clear, actionable activation strategies.
  • Collaboration & Influence: Proven ability to partner cross‑functionally and align execution with national and global priorities.
  • Exceptional Communication: Clear, confident communicator across functions, seniority levels, regions, and cultures—written, verbal, and visual.
  • Results‑Driven Approach: Strong focus on commercial performance, ROI, and continuous improvement.
  • Agility & Adaptability: Thrives in a fast‑paced, matrixed environment with shifting priorities.
  • Project & Campaign Leadership: Demonstrated success leading complex, multi‑stakeholder initiatives from planning through execution.
  • Attention to Detail: Ensures flawless execution across consumer, marketplace, and retail activations.
  • Customer‑Centric Mindset: Passion for creating best‑in‑class experiences at every touchpoint.

Ownership & Accountability: Takes full ownership of initiatives and consistently delivers results.
